Gaskin Maneuver: A shoulder dystocia management procedure, the Gaskin Maneuver requires the mother to kneel on all fours. The mother arches her back, and the pelvis is widened.

The overwhelming majority of patients with locked-in syndrome never make a full recovery. Most never make any improvement, even a small or incremental one. There are cases of patients completely reversing the condition, but they are exceedingly rare and usually happen because the underlying cause is treatable and gets addressed within hours of onset.
